A device that clamps on to a Tesla Model S interior rearview mirror stem, and provides a flat mounting surface for a dashcam (it could also be used for radar detectors, etc.). The camera end is just a solid tongue that you can drill through to hold the camera. The clip is designed to hide the dashcam from the driver's point of view. Note: the first image is upside-down.Made on AutoDesk Inventor 2015. Took measurements from the Model S mirror stem for a custom fit. Sliced in Cura. Scale up 10x to print. Printed 100% infill black ABS at layer height 0.3 mm on a Printrbot Simple Metal with heated bed. Added self-adhesive silicone grip pads to the inside of the clip to prevent the clip from sliding down the plastic mirror stem. Used a nylon bolt and acorn nut, filed to fit the camera mount and drilled a hole through the tongue of this part.
